Veils of Truth
By
Jerry D. Smith
The embers glow softly reposing on the hearth as the five a.m. fire burns lifelessly to its inevitable, self-consumed termination. What fiery glow it once experienced is now but listless, smoldering ashes which eventually return to the evangelical dust that has been prophesized for you and me. Who shall remember this once fiery blaze but the keepers of the unrecorded, who, in all their charge, note the veils of truth for those who are so blind that they cannot see. And these keepers whisper these truths to the four winds to be carried to those who look beyond the misty haze of reality into the spiritualness of the universe without fear nor judgment, and then understand the pure truths – all that is was; and all that was, is.
